SAN DIEGO, September 14, 1992--Aldus Corporation today announced two new
libraries of Gallery Effects image-enhancement effects and version 1.5 of
the Aldus Gallery Effects application for the Apple Macintosh and
Microsoft Windows. The two new libraries are Gallery Effects: Classic Art,
Volume 2, and Gallery Effects: Texture Art. Developed by the Aldus
Consumer Division, the Gallery Effects collection is designed to let users
easily add visual impact to printed and electronic documents.

Multiple effects turn images into art 

Each effect in a Gallery Effects library can be applied alone or with
others to turn scanned photographs and other bitmap images into
eye-catching artwork. Well-designed controls enable users to achieve
artistic results easily, reliably, and consistently. Customers can, for
example, apply effects to an entire image or selected areas, build effects
on top of others, and customize the effects for dozens of variations, then
save them for future use.

All effects are available as plug-in filters that users can apply from
within the Gallery Effects application or any other Macintosh or Windows
program that supports plug-in technology. These plug-ins enable users to
preview effects before applying them, providing convenient and powerful
image enhancement capabilities. All plug-ins appear as an integral part of
their host programs, which include Aldus PhotoStyler 1.1 and Fractal
Design Painter for Windows, and Adobe Photoshop, Aldus SuperPaint, Aldus
Digital Darkroom, Fractal Design Painter, Adobe Premiere, PixelPaint
Professional 2.0, ColorStudio 1.5, and StrataVision 3D 2.5 for the
Macintosh.

Gallery Effects: Classic Art, Volume 2 

Aldus Gallery Effects: Classic Art, Volume 2 will continue in the artistic
tradition of Volume 1 supply a new library of painterly effects that
emphasize bold painting and drawing styles, as well as photographic
effects. The 16 new filters will be Accented Edges, Angled Strokes, Bas
Relief, Colored Pencil, Diffuse Glow, Glowing Edges, Grain, Note Paper,
Palette Knife, Patchwork, Photocopy, Rough Pastels, Sprayed Strokes,
Stamp, Texturizer, and Underpainting.

Gallery Effects: Texture Art 

Aldus Gallery Effects: Texture Art will include 125 photograph-quality
textures in 12 categories-- Brick, Fabric, Gravel, Ground, Marble, Metal,
Plant, Shingle, Stone, Tile, Wall, and Wood. The Texture Art library is
being developed exclusively for Aldus by Pixar, creators of leading
photo-realilstic rendering software.

Unlike other competing products, Texture Art will automatically and
seamlessly tile a texture to any size or shape. Users will also be able to
import and apply their own images as tiles; the imported files can come
from other texture packages, PICT and TIFF files on the Macintosh, and TIF
and BMP files on Windows. Once applied, textured images will be adjustable
for brightness, contrast, and color balance for wide variations. Textures
can also be incorporated into presentations, published documents, or as
backgrounds for other enhanced images.

The textures in Texture Art will be provided in a compact, low-resolution
format (72 dpi, 8 bit) so they can be applied quickly. The package will
also include a CD-ROM of the 125 textures in both the low-resolution
format and a locked, high-resolution proprietary format (300 dpi, 24 bit).
An unlock code will be provided for one high-resolution texture; users
will be able to purchase additional codes for the other high-resolution
textures.

Gallery Effects 1.5 update 

With the introduction of the new effects volumes, Aldus is also updating
the application in the award winning Gallery Effects: Classic Art, Volume
1 package from version 1.0 to version 1.5. The updated version will
include enhancements to the Gallery Effects application for saving files
in 8-bit format as well as in the existing 24-bit format. The package will
also include sample effects from the Classic Ar Volume 2 and Texture Art
volumes.

Pricing and availability 

Aldus Gallery Effects 1.5 will become the core application in the growing
family of effects. It will be available through Aldus resellers in the
fourth quarter of 1992 in the U.S. and Canada for a suggested retail price
of $199 (U.S.), and will include the original Classic Art, Volume 1
effects. Registered owners of version 1.0 will automatically receive the
1.5 version for free.

Gallery Effects: Classic Art, Volume 2 and Gallery Effects: Texture Art are
the first effects libraries to enhance the core application. These
libraries will be available directly from the Aldus Consumer Division by
calling (800) 888-6293, ext. 2. Gallery Effects: Classic Art, Volume 2
will be priced at $99 (U.S.). Gallery Effects: Texture Art will have a
special introductory price of $99 (U.S.); the regular price will be $199.
Unlock codes for the high-resolution textures on the Gallery Effects:
Texture Art CD-ROM disk will be $29 per texture, $99 for five textures, or
$1,995 for all 125 textures. Both libraries will be available in the
fourth quarter of 1992 in the U.S. and Canada.

System configuration 

Under Windows, Gallery Effects requires Microsoft Windows 3.0 (or later)
and Windows 3.0-compatible hardware. The recommended system configuration
is a 486- or 386-based Windows-compatible computer with 4MB of RAM, an
80MB hard drive, a CD-ROM drive for Texture Art, a 16- or 24-bit graphics
card and monitor, and a mouse or other pointing device. The minimum system
configuration is a 286-based Windows-compatible computer with 2MB of RAM,
a 20MB hard drive, any Windows compatible graphics display card and
monitor, and a mouse.

On the Macintosh, the recommended system configuration is an Apple
Macintosh II series, Macintosh LC, or SE/30 computer with a color monitor
and card; 4MB of RAM (2MB minimum); a hard drive; a CD-ROM drive for
Texture Art; System 6.0.5 or later, Finder 6.1 or later, and 32-bit
QuickDraw 1.2. Gallery Effects is compatible with System 7.0.

When the effects are used as plug-ins from within other programs, the
system configuration is determined by the host program.
